His Trash, My Treasure
I got my Explorer from a Quality Auto and they thought they were going to beat me, that I was just a dumb college kid. It was making a funny sound and everyone thought it was the tranny. I paid 1000 down and was willing to take the risk. Turns out it was only the ball joints. I love the car it has a smooth ride, and AC after 16 years. I'm happy and wouldn't trade it.

What a lemon!
I can't believe all of the things that went wrong with this vehicle! Transmissions, count 'em, we did two, now needs repairs again! Went through brake pads so fast we thought they were faulty! Little things always went wrong, but $$$$to fix...gas gauge went, required entire new dash, ignition, still usable but a pain in the neck, all four door handles were broken and floppy. on and on and on...to top it off, very tippy and unstable feeling....finally rolled it!
